Projector lenses been available in various kinds, each developed for details uses and settings. General-purpose lenses are frequently used in daily home theaters, offering a well balanced performance for motion pictures, gaming, and other multimedia presentations. Wide-angle lenses, on the various other hand, succeed in situations where forecasting huge images from short distances is needed. They are excellent for smaller spaces where area is restricted, permitting users to put the projector near to the display without sacrificing image size or top quality. Alternatively, long-throw lenses are made for larger places, enabling projectors to provide outstanding picture dimensions from substantial ranges. These lenses are commonly employed in auditoriums, class, and big meeting room.
The focal length of a projector lens is an important specification to think about. Customers need to assess the physical restrictions of their setting, such as ceiling height and the distance from the projector to the screen, as these aspects straight influence the selection of lens.
Zoom lenses permit for modifications in image dimension without physically moving the projector, giving versatility in setup and usage. It is important to note that zoom lenses can occasionally jeopardize image high quality at specific zoom degrees compared to fixed lenses, which are customized for certain forecast ranges.
In enhancement to focal size and zoom ability, lens aperture plays a substantial role in a projector's illumination and overall efficiency. A lens's aperture identifies the amount of light that can pass with it to get to the display. A larger aperture allows for even more light transmission, resulting in brighter photos and improved performance in ambient light conditions. This particular is especially appropriate for environments with high degrees of ambient light, such as boardroom or classrooms. Optical layers on projector lenses also add to their efficiency, specifically when it pertains to enhancing and reducing reflections color accuracy. Top notch lenses commonly come furnished with several finishings that decrease glare and improve comparison, enabling for clearer and much more vivid photos. When reviewing projector lenses, customers ought to look for those with anti-reflective layers for optimum seeing experiences, particularly in settings where lights problems can be variable.

Furthermore, understanding the idea of lens change is vital for anyone thinking about making use of a projector. Lens shift allows individuals to readjust the position of the picture up and down or horizontally without moving the projector itself. This attribute is invaluable for accomplishing a flawlessly aligned picture, particularly in scenarios where the projector must be put off-center or at various elevations from the display. Lens shift can assist prevent keystone distortion, an usual concern that arises when the projector is not vertical to the display, bring about skewed image shapes. By integrating lens change right into their arrangement, customers can keep photo quality while taking pleasure in the versatility of their positioning alternatives.

Correct maintenance and treatment for projector lenses can improve their long life and efficiency. Normal cleaning is required to eliminate dust, fingerprints, and various other contaminants that may accumulate gradually. Users must consult the maker's guidelines to make sure that cleansing methods do not harm the lens coating. Additionally, appropriate storage and defense of the lens when not in use are important to avoid scratches and various other kinds of damage that might hinder photo quality.
